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
160818824 61659067788 603
33035404 12
33035404 12
9720415076 082 15401828
All about undefined
Interested in learning more?
33035404 12
9720415076 082 15401828
See more
99 4994617 125
35 3215712 35279853368
See more
9185993 308839
514786989 22 1797052767 1155607
See more